## AI overview

Sam Lau describes how Khan Academy improved copy-pasting in Perseus, its interactive exercise and article editor, by moving widget metadata alongside copied text. The change preserves information such as image URLs and a number line's starting value, making it easier for content creators to move or duplicate widgets.
